Face Geometry Reconstrucion (PyTorch)

This repository include scripts to

  1. Sample and visualize 3D flame models
  2. Fit a flame model to an image using 2D landmarks
  3. Fit a flame model to a video using 2D landmarks
  4. Visualize the results of the video fitting

Set-up

The has been tested with Python3.7, using pyTorch 1.4.0. Install mesh processing libraries from MPI-IS/mesh within the virtual environment.

Make sure your pip version is up-to-date:

pip install -U pip

Other requirements (including pyTorch) can be installed using:

pip install -r requirements.txt

The visualization uses OpenGL and vtkplotter which can be installed using:

sudo apt-get install python-opengl
pip install -U vtkplotter

The Flame model need to be placed under the 'model' folder. It can be download from MPI-IS/FLAME. You need to sign up and agree to the model license for access to the model and the data. We also have it on our drive.

Sample FLAME

This demo introduces the different FLAME parameters: shape, expression, neck, jaw.

python flame_params_demo.py
Fit a flame to an image 2D landmarks and project a texture
python ./fit_2D_landmarks_to_image.py
Or to change an image
python ./fit_2D_landmarks_to_image.py --target_img_path ./data/bareteeth.000001.26_C.jpg
Fit a flame to a video (set of images) with 2D landmarks and project their texture
python ./fit_multiple_images.py --input_folder PATH-TO-VOCA_PICTURES-SET --output_folder PATH-TO-RESULTS-FOLDER

And to visualize the results simply run:
python ./visualize_video_reconstruction.py --input_folder PATH-TO-VIDEO_RESULTS_FOLDER
